EMAF Tokyo 2014

Sat Oct 18 - Sun Oct 19, 2014 Liquidroom

Time Out says

Taking place as part of this year's Red Bull Music Academy, the second Japan edition of EMAF has put together an interesting and eclectic lineup. The opening day will see the main stage taken over by British veteran producer Luke Vibert, followed by appearances by digital experimentalist Holly Herndon and Matt Cutler aka Lone, while Sunday is dedicated to names like Untold and Matthewdavid.
